West Point is consistently ranked as one of America’s best universities. Located on a beautiful, wooded campus along New York’s Hudson River, West Point was founded in 1802 to educate and train young men for service as military officers in defense of our nation. In addition to rigorous coursework, cadets also complete two summers of military training prior to graduation. No matter where they go after graduation, cadets will leave West Point with skills that translate into success both on and off the battlefield—leadership, discipline, confidence and integrity—as well as powerful lifelong connections with other members of their class.
